前端大屏数据可视化实践

时光旅行者酱 2021-04-29 ⋅ 21 阅读

在现代信息时代,数据成为了企业决策和发展中不可或缺的一部分。而为了更好地展示和解读数据,大屏数据可视化逐渐成为了各行业领域的热门趋势。在前端领域,借助现代的可视化技术和工具,我们可以更加直观和有效地展示和分析数据,从而帮助企业做出更明智的决策。

什么是大屏数据可视化

大屏数据可视化是一种将丰富多样的数据以可视化的形式进行展示的技术。通过将数据呈现在大屏幕上,可以让用户更加直观地了解数据的趋势、关系和模式。大屏数据可视化不仅仅是简单的图表和统计数据,还可以利用音频、视频、动画等多种媒介形式来展示数据,从而更好地吸引用户的注意力和理解。

前端大屏数据可视化的技术手段

在前端开发中,我们可以利用多种技术手段来进行大屏数据可视化的实践。

1. 数据获取和处理

在进行大屏数据可视化之前,首先需要获取和处理数据。可以通过网络请求或者其他方式从后端或者实时数据源获取数据,然后对数据进行处理和清洗,以便能够更好地进行可视化展示。

2. 数据可视化图表库

在选择数据可视化图表库时,需要根据实际需求和数据特点选择合适的图表类型。常见的数据可视化图表库包括echarts、Highcharts、D3等,它们提供了丰富的图表类型和交互功能,可以帮助我们更好地展示和解读数据。

3. 数据可视化布局和设计

布局和设计是大屏数据可视化中非常重要的一环。合理的布局和设计可以提升用户的体验和数据传达效果。可以利用HTML、CSS、JavaScript等技术实现自定义的布局和设计,使大屏数据可视化更加美观和易于理解。

4. 实时更新和交互功能

为了满足大屏数据可视化的实时性和交互性需求,我们可以借助WebSocket等技术实现数据的实时更新和展示。同时,通过与用户的交互,可以让用户根据自己的需求对数据进行选择、筛选和排序,从而更好地理解和分析数据。

5. 响应式布局和多屏适配

考虑到不同设备和屏幕的差异性,响应式布局和多屏适配是大屏数据可视化的一个重要问题。可以利用CSS的媒体查询和弹性布局技术,使数据可视化界面在不同屏幕尺寸下能够自适应布局,确保用户在不同设备上都能够良好地体验和使用大屏数据可视化。

前端大屏数据可视化实践示例

以下是一个简单的前端大屏数据可视化实践示例,展示了如何利用echarts和CSS技术实现一个简单的数据可视化系统。

# 前端大屏数据可视化实践示例

## 1. 数据获取和处理

通过网络请求从后端获取数据,并进行处理和清洗。

## 2. 数据可视化图表库

选择使用echarts图表库来展示数据。利用柱状图、饼图等丰富的图表类型,展示数据的关系和趋势。

## 3. 数据可视化布局和设计

使用HTML、CSS技术实现自定义的布局和设计。通过合理的排版和颜色搭配,提升数据可视化的效果和用户体验。

## 4. 实时更新和交互功能

利用WebSocket技术实现数据的实时更新和展示。通过与用户的交互,实现数据的选择、筛选和排序功能。

## 5. 响应式布局和多屏适配

利用CSS的媒体查询和弹性布局技术,实现数据可视化界面的响应式布局和多屏适配。

以上是一个简单的前端大屏数据可视化实践示例,通过合理地运用前端技术,我们可以更好地展示和解读数据,帮助企业做出更明智的决策。

以上是一个简单的前端大屏数据可视化实践的示例,借助现代的前端技术和工具,我们可以更加直观和有效地展示和分析数据,为企业决策提供有力支持。希望对大家有所启发!


全部评论: 0

    我有话说: